The ingredients needed to make Cauliflower gratin with healthy béchamel sauce recipe:
  1. Prepare 1 cauliflower, separated into florets
  2. Prepare 1 small onion, sliced
  3. Take 1 leek, sliced (white part only)
  4. Take 600 g peeled courgette (salted to remove excess water)
  5. Take 200 g water
  6. Prepare 150 g skimmed milk
  7. Take 4 small low-calorie cheeses
  8. Prepare Extra Virgin Olive Oil from Spain
  9. Take Salt
  10. Prepare Pepper
  11. Get Nutmeg
  12. Make ready Low-calorie cheese for the gratin topping

Instructions to make Cauliflower gratin with healthy béchamel sauce recipe:
  1. Separate the cauliflower into florets and boil them in the milk with half the water, a pinch of salt and two tablespoons of Extra Virgin Olive Oil from Spain.
  2. Meanwhile, start preparing the courgette béchamel.
  3. Put 4 tablespoons of Extra Virgin Olive Oil from Spain in a saucepan and gently fry the onion and leek over low heat, making sure they don’t burn, which would affect the color of the béchamel sauce.
  4. Add the peeled, chopped courgette and sauté for five minutes.
  5. Next, add the water, milk, pepper and nutmeg to taste and simmer for 20 minutes.
  6. Blend with a hand-held blender and add the cheeses to make a creamy béchamel sauce. Season to taste and set aside.
  7. In a casserole dish, arrange the cauliflower florets. Pour the low-calorie béchamel sauce over the top with the grated low-calorie cheese. Put the dish in the oven at 180ºC, until the cheese bubbles and turns golden.​
